CBT was founded by higher education professionals who saw a gap in the ecosystem - and built something to fill it. Not another consulting firm. A curated network of practitioners who've actually held the roles.
CBT launched in 2008 - one of the most difficult moments in higher education's recent history. While institutions were left to navigate the financial crisis largely alone, we were there. Providing experienced, steady counsel when it was needed most.
That commitment has never wavered. Through every challenge that followed, CBT has shown up - not with generic playbooks, but with practitioners who understand the terrain and partners who stay the course.
Seventeen years later, we're still here. And so are the institutions we serve.
CBT founded during the financial crisis, supporting colleges through unprecedented uncertainty.
200+ engagements across community colleges, universities, and nonprofits nationwide.
COVID-19 disrupts higher ed. CBT partners with institutions navigating remote transitions, budget crises, and enrollment drops.
AI reshapes the landscape. CBT helps institutions build thoughtful, mission-grounded AI strategies.

CBT is nationally certified by the Western Regional Minority Supplier Development Council. Our certificate number is WR971091 and expires 07/31/2027. We are more than happy to provide our certificate upon request.
